Blood Drive

   A funny little story to begin. We took our son Malakai (5) to the park this weekend and along the road were signs promoting a Blood Drive that was taking place. Malakai is a huge Scooby-Doo fan, and his imagination is always on full-force, and blood is NOT his favorite subject.. lol. [just to paint a mental picture for you to surround the following conversation]:

Malakai: Daddy!! Did you see that? They call this road.. **dramatic gulp of fear** BLOOD DRIVE!!
Mom and Dad: **insert hysterical laughter**

Dad: No buddy, a blood drive is when you give your blood to help save someones life who may need it.
Malakai: **insert look of disgust and horror** 


  Conversations like these are why I love being around kids!! But also, because their innocence teaches us so much, they are truly pure in spirit. There's nothing better in this life, when God uses your own child and information you taught them to speak to you. So as funny as the conversation on Saturday was.. Sunday it came back to blow me away. 

  Sunday we went to the early service, and during announcements, the speaker shared upcoming events and the fact there was a blood drive taking place on campus. I started to giggle, as Malakai's eyes grew wide hearing the words BLOOD DRIVE in church. Then he breathed a sigh of relief and giggled saying "Oh I know.. they're talking about the blood drive Jesus did." It made me stop giggling, and just look at my beautiful child in astonishment with the connection he made. What a concept!

   Since then, it's been playing over in my mind.. "the blood drive Jesus did." In essence, that is what He did.. He GAVE blood, so that WE may have LIFE! I love when I get a new perspective on what Jesus gave. Through our belief and proclamation of the life of Jesus Christ and the fact that He died on the cross in atonement for us, is like getting a blood transfusion. It gives life to a dying soul, it gives us a new beginning.. and His blood type matches everyone's, you just need to ask for it! It replenishes and enhances. Without this transfusion, you will die. His blood adds to your life, what you cannot do on your own. 

 Though His blood drive happened on earth years ago... it has yet to expire and never will. Transfusions are available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week
